Default f150 both fuel pumps keep running

They usually run for a second or 2 and shut off and the truck will start. Today I turned the key on and either pump will just keep running and it wont start. Changed the fuel filter but it was super easy to blow thru so I don't think that is it. Where should I look. Thanks. I have trouble walking and now I have nothing to drive

There are so many things electrically controlled in vehicles today. The first and usually easiest thing to check is , all the fuses. You have fuse blocks in the engine compartment and inside the vehicle. If you have the owners manual it may save you some time by telling you what each fuse controls. Lets try this first, OK?
